# Break-Glass Access — Squatterwatch Scanner

This page governs emergency access to the Squatterwatch typo-squatting package scanner when its maintainers are unreachable during an active registry incident. Break-glass use requires sign-off from the duty security reviewer and creates a permanent audit entry. Retrieve the sealed escrow bundle, verify its tamper seal and checksum, and document the time of opening. The recovery passphrase for the escrow bundle is stated below.

unlock words, hahip-yagef: zorok-novmir-zorix-silax

- [ ] Key ceremony, step 4: rotate the Brellix partner SFTP drop credentials before Quorvane's Friday batch lands. Two custodians present, per the Tallowmere runbook. Verify the new host key fingerprint against the sealed envelope, confirm the drop directory ACLs, then re-encrypt the staging manifest. Old key gets shredded on camera. If the Quorvane feed stalls mid-cutover, roll back using the escrow bundle in the ceremony safe. The bundle unlocks with the recovery passphrase recorded below.

unlock words, yawig-kagef: gordor-holvan-ulaael-pramir-ulaiel-tamdor

# Break-Glass Access — LiftQueue Simulator

Use only if the LiftQueue elevator-dispatch simulator is down and normal auth fails. Page the secondary on-call first. Break-glass unlocks the admin console for 30 minutes; all actions are logged. Rotate credentials after use. To activate, open the console lock screen and enter the recovery passphrase shown below.

recovery phrase for fawif-tajeg: norael-aldmir-casir-brivan-ulaion

## Runbook: Zero-downtime schema migrations

For the Dovetail service, run migrations in expand-contract order: add nullable columns first, deploy readers, then backfill via `dovemigrate --batch 500`. Never drop columns in the same release window. Verify replica lag stays under two seconds before the contract phase. The migration runner authenticates against the primary, so append its credential on the following line.

secret setting of fawep-tagaf: ARCHIVE_KEY3=ce5